    Abstract: A spring link includes a link body which includes two side wall profiles which are parallel to one another at a distance and which are connected by a spring seat plate extending transversely from one side wall profile to the other side wall profile. Each side wall profile includes a side web having an outwardly directed upper collar section which extends in the longitudinal direction of the side web. The spring seat plate rests with a lateral longitudinal edge section on an upper collar section and is joined to the upper collar section. The side wall profiles of the link body are mirror-symmetrical to one another. The lower side of the link body opposite to the spring seat plate is open.

    Abstract: A spring control arm for a wheel suspension of a motor vehicle is formed as a single-shell, essentially U-shaped sheet metal part and includes a back, spaced-apart side walls adjoining the back and each having an upper side wall region connected to the back, a lower side wall region distal from the back, and a central side wall region arranged between the upper and lower side wall regions. The spring control arm has first and a second end sections for attachment and a wider spring plate region disposed therebetween. The spring control arm has a substantially omega-shaped cross section in the spring plate region, which is more pronounced in a central longitudinal section due to outwardly projecting upper side wall sections than in an end longitudinal section of the spring plate region.

    Abstract: The present invention relates to a spring link for a motor vehicle, wherein the spring link is produced as an elongated, deformed hollow profile of open cross section made of a steel material and has respective attachment points at its ends, said spring link being characterized in that the spring link, in the installed position, is arranged with its opening of the hollow profile pointing upward, wherein a spring seat plate for receiving a helical compression spring is coupled to the spring link on and/or partially in the opening.

    Abstract: The invention concerns a multipiece spring link (100) for a wheel suspension of a vehicle, with: a first profiled side piece (101), forming a first side leg of the multipiece spring link (100), wherein the first profiled side piece (101) has a first bulge (105); a second profiled side piece (103), forming a second side leg of the multipiece spring link (100), wherein the second profiled side piece (103) has a second bulge (107); and wherein the first bulge (105) and the second bulge (107) are arranged one opposite the other and together form a spring receiving region (108) for the receiving of a spring.

    Abstract: In a method for producing a control arm for arrangement on an automobile axle formed as one-piece part from a light-metal extruded profile, a semi-finished product made from a light-metal extruded profile having a Pi-shaped cross-sectional configuration with a bottom web, side webs extending from the bottom web, and legs projecting from the webs is processed by cutting, whereafter bearing seat openings are introduced and sections of the processed semi-finished product are expanded. A control arm produced with the method of the invention for arrangement on an automobile axle is also disclosed.

    Abstract: A control arm for installation to an axle of a motor vehicle includes a base body made of sheet metal and having three bearing zones. The base body has two suspension arms to define a base body plane. One of the bearing zones includes two bearing receptacles, each having a receiving opening disposed in an opening plane. The opening plane of one of the receiving openings and the opening plane of the other one of the receiving openings are disposed in spaced-apart relationship and oriented in substantial perpendicular relationship to the base body plane.

    Abstract: A transverse control arm for a motor vehicle is produced in one piece from a sheet metal blank. The transverse control arm includes a base body region with bearing regions formed thereon. A bearing journal is arranged in a bearing region with a material joint. The material joint is oriented in the direction of a longitudinal axis of the bearing journal, thereby providing a transverse control arm with high durability.
